Gramática

Incorrect use of quantifiers

× I am a good at memorizing things and I can memorize everything that happened around me and the name of people that I visited.

I am good at memorizing things and I can memorize everything that happens around me and the names of people that I meet.

The phrase 'a good at' is incorrect; 'good at' does not require an article. 'Everything that happened' should be 'everything that happens' to match the present tense context. 'The name of people' should be pluralized to 'the names of people' to agree with the plural noun 'people'. Also, 'that I visited' is unclear; 'that I meet' fits better for people encountered regularly.

Past tense issue

× Yes, of course I've forgotten some important memories about different things.

Yes, of course I've forgotten some important things.

The phrase 'important memories about different things' is awkward and redundant. 'Memories' are not typically 'forgotten' in this context; it's clearer to say 'important things'. The present perfect tense 'I've forgotten' is correct here.

Sentence structure errors

× For example, one time I forgot the name of the street my mother was and so I couldn't get.

For example, one time I forgot the name of the street where my mother was, so I couldn't find it.

The sentence is incomplete and unclear. 'The street my mother was' lacks a preposition; 'where my mother was' is correct. 'I couldn't get' is incomplete; 'I couldn't find it' clarifies the meaning.

Singular and plural issue

× There are many think that I I have to remember, for example, the name of the street I live and the name of the street at my workplace is and the name of people I meet every day and work with them and all some such information.

There are many things that I have to remember, for example, the name of the street I live on, the name of the street where my workplace is, the names of people I meet every day and work with, and other such information.

'Many think' should be 'many things' to match the plural noun. 'The name of the street I live' needs the preposition 'on'. 'The name of the street at my workplace is' is incomplete; it should be 'the name of the street where my workplace is'. 'The name of people' should be pluralized to 'the names of people'. The phrase 'and all some such information' is awkward; 'and other such information' is clearer.

Incorrect use of prepositions

× For example, for some concepts in my studies I used some formula for remembering them and for other topics I use some reminder apps in my mobile phone to reminder me.

For example, for some concepts in my studies, I use some formulas to remember them, and for other topics, I use reminder apps on my mobile phone to remind me.

'Used' should be 'use' to maintain present tense consistency. 'Some formula' should be plural 'some formulas' to match the plural 'concepts'. 'For remembering them' is better expressed as 'to remember them'. 'Reminder apps in my mobile phone' should be 'reminder apps on my mobile phone'. 'To reminder me' is incorrect; the verb form is 'to remind me'.
